Netflix‘s dystopian survival thriller “Squid Recreation” Season 3 emerged as the highest worldwide title amongst Indian streaming audiences within the first half of 2025, rating fifth total with 16.5 million viewers, whereas JioHotstar‘s authorized drama “Legal Justice: A Household Matter” claimed the No. 1 spot, in accordance ito new information from Ormax Media.

“Legal Justice: A Household Matter,” the courtroom sequence, produced by Applause Leisure and BBC Studios India, drew 27.7 million viewers throughout the January-June interval, narrowly edging out Amazon MX Participant’s crime drama “Ek Badnaam Aashram” Season 3 Half 2 (27.1 million) and Prime Video’s beloved rural comedy-drama “Panchayat” Season 4 (23.8 million).

The tight race on the high displays intensifying competitors for India’s streaming viewers, with JioHotstar – India’s high streamer with 300 million subscribers – demonstrating outstanding energy throughout a number of genres. The platform secured seven titles within the high 50, together with animated sequence “The Legend of Hanuman” Season 6 at No. 6 (16.2 million viewers) and thriller “The Secret of the Shiledars” at No. 8 (14.5 million viewers).

Prime Video confirmed sturdy efficiency with 4 top-20 entries, led by its continued partnership with The Viral Fever (TVF) on “Panchayat” and medical drama “Gram Chikitsalay” (11.8 million viewers). The platform additionally captured audiences with Tamil-language crime sequence “Suzhal – The Vortex” Season 2 (8.3 million viewers) and worldwide motion sequence “Reacher” Season 3 (7.5 million viewers).

The Ormax information reveals Indian viewers’ sustained urge for food for crime dramas and authorized thrillers, with small-town narratives performing notably properly. Actuality programming additionally demonstrated sturdy attraction, with Amazon MX Participant’s music competitors “Hip Hop India” Season 2 (11.1 million viewers) and Netflix’s comedy selection present “The Nice Indian Kapil Present” Season 3 (10.9 million viewers) each cracking the highest 20.

The sturdy efficiency of “Squid Recreation” – produced by Firstman Studio and Siren Photos – underscores the continued world attraction of worldwide content material in India, whilst native productions dominated the higher reaches of Ormax’s high 50 rankings. Amongst Netflix’s worldwide fare, English crime drama “Adolescence” (8.7 million viewers) and Korean romantic drama “When Life Provides You Tangerines” (5.9 million viewers) made the rankings.

Whereas worldwide content material maintained presence all through the rankings – together with HBO post-apocalyptic drama “The Final of Us” Season 2 (8 million viewers) and Marvel superhero sequence “Daredevil: Born Once more” (6.8 million viewers), each on JioHotstar, – Hindi-language productions dominated the higher tiers, suggesting native storytelling stays paramount for streaming success in India.

Ormax Media’s viewership estimates are based mostly on weekly main analysis performed throughout India and a number of languages, projected to the nation’s streaming universe. The methodology counts particular person viewers who watched not less than one full episode of a sequence or half-hour of a movie, accounting for shared viewing on single accounts and together with entry by way of unauthorized means.

The analysis covers content material launched between January and June 2025, with some late-June releases nonetheless being tracked. All language variations and dubbed content material are included, although estimates are restricted to the Indian market.
